Original Description
Henryk Heinrich Rauchinger's Slowakische Bauernhochzeit (Slovak Peasant Wedding) is a vibrant celebration of rural Slovak life, capturing the joy and communal spirit of a traditional wedding feast. Painted in the late 19th or early 20th century, the work reflects Rauchinger's academic training and his keen eye for ethnographic detail, blending realism with a touch of romanticized folklorism. The composition brims with movement—dancing figures, lively musicians, and richly adorned guests—all rendered in warm earthy tones punctuated by bursts of festive reds and whites. Rauchinger, a Polish-Austrian artist known for historical and genre scenes, offers a valuable glimpse into Central European peasant culture, situating the painting within the broader tradition of 19th-century European genre painting that sought to document vanishing rural traditions. Its historical authenticity and narrative charm make it a notable, if lesser-known, example of regional realism.
